OHIO — A man was arrested following a drug bust conducted by police in Dayton on Thursday, authorities said.

According to a social media post from the Dayton Police Department, detectives served a search warrant in the 300 block of Richmond Avenue on Feb. 5. During the search, officers seized approximately 1,308.8 grams of fentanyl, 134.8 grams of crack cocaine, and about 10,000 pressed fentanyl pills.

Police also reported seizing six firearms, several rounds of ammunition, and $138,751 in cash from the residence.

A 34-year-old man was taken into custody, and charges are being presented to the Montgomery County Prosecutor’s Office, according to the department.

While police did not publicly identify the suspect, records from the Montgomery County Jail show that Keith Devon Jones, 34, was arrested at 312 Richmond Avenue on suspicion of drug trafficking and drug possession charges early Wednesday morning.

The investigation remains ongoing.
